AI for Customer Service
Customers are the heart of any business, but handling service requests and queries can quickly become overwhelming. That’s why AI-powered customer service tools are a game-changer.
1. Smart Chatbots
Meet the workers who’ll never call in sick—chatbots! Tools like ChatGPT and Tidio handle common customer inquiries in real time. These bots answer FAQs, troubleshoot issues, and even take orders, so you can provide 24/7 service without needing a coffee-fueled team around the clock.
2. Help Desk Automation
If your team spends ages sorting through customer tickets, it’s time to introduce them to Zendesk AI or Freshdesk’s Freddy AI. These solutions categorize and route tickets automatically, helping human agents focus on solving more complex cases faster.
AI in Operations
Behind the scenes, AI can also tidy up your operations department. From data analysis to project management, here’s how AI can boost your day-to-day efficiency.
1. Project Management AI
When your to-do list is as long as a CVS receipt, keeping everything on track can become a headache. Enter tools like Trello AI Assist and monday.com AI, which help prioritize tasks, suggest project timelines, and improve team collaboration. They’re like having a proactive assistant who keeps the ball rolling.
2. Data Analysis
Data can be powerful—if you know how to handle it… AI tools like Tableau and Looker turn complex data sets into easy-to-digest visuals, offering actionable insights in moments. Want to see which product is tanking or where you’re losing customer engagement? These tools provide answers in a flash, helping you adjust your strategies on-the-go.
How to Choose the Right AI Tool
With so many options out there, how do you pick the right AI tools for your small business? Start with these quick tips to find your perfect match.
- Define Your Goals: Do you want to improve customer experiences? Simplify marketing? Knowing your goals will guide your decision.
- Test First: Many tools offer free trials to help you dip your toes in before committing.
- Check for Integrations: Choose tools that work seamlessly with your existing platforms, whether that’s Google Workspace, Slack, or good old spreadsheets.
- Scalability Is Key: Make sure the tool can grow with you as your business expands.
